Transaction f221e170afdea7a5154b1e7c60ea28f4b65c1a34aa505b6ec7ae011aa34bb8c0

1 Input
1 Outputs
  • f221e170afdea7a5154b1e7c60ea28f4b65c1a34aa505b6ec7ae011aa34bb8c0:0
  • value  2527319015
    address  152f1muMCNa7goXYhYAQC61hxEgGacmncB